## Changelog — 3.9.1

Rotated the Fernwick calendar-sync signing key after the conflict-resolution bug shipped in 3.9.0. Root cause: overlapping sync windows caused duplicate event writes, and the stale key was cached by the merge worker, so conflicts resolved against outdated signatures. Merge worker now refetches keys on conflict. Reviewer: confirm the cache TTL drop to 60s. Old key revoked as of this release. New signing key follows below.

rollout seal: bky9_PeXH1fTLY

Build Provenance — Lanternpay Integration Tests. The payments suite on Lanternpay has three known flaky tests, all in the settlement retry path. Flakes correlate with the sandbox clearinghouse stub timing out under parallel runs. Before quarantining a test, confirm it failed on two consecutive builds from the same commit, not just one. Provenance matters here: every quarantine request must cite the exact build that exhibited the failure. Copy the build token shown below into the quarantine form.

pipeline stamp: htk31_f769b577b3028a4e9958e5bb8d1259a

## Service Accounts: Drafthatch History Service

Undo and redo in the Drafthatch diagram editor are handled by a separate history service, which stores per-document operation logs. When a customer reports missing undo steps, support can query the history service directly instead of asking engineering. Read access requires the shared support service account; it cannot modify or replay operations, only inspect them. Lookups are limited to documents the customer has shared for troubleshooting. Authenticate your queries with the key below.

gateway credential: kto3_qfe

**Ticket: Bump Ferrypost broker client to 3.x**

This change upgrades the Ferrypost client library across the Oakhollow services and removes the deprecated ack-batching shim. Reviewer notes: retry semantics moved into config, so check the new defaults in the consumer module. Tested against the staging broker at Dunmarsh. The candidate build is identified by the token below.

session token of tajef-bageg = htk21_5d90d574934f3ccae6437